dc.description.abstractCross-border Multi Casualty Incidents require harmonised information frameworks to ensure effective coordination and decision-making. This study aims to define a minimum data set for the management of such incidents using a modified Delphi methodology within the VALKYRIES Horizon 2020 project. Expert consensus was achieved on essential data elements, facilitating interoperability, improving communication among emergency services, and supporting coordinated response across borders. The proposed data set contributes to standardisation efforts and enhances preparedness and operational efficiency in large-scale emergencies.es
